It is very common in medical imaging that the anatomy of interest occupies only a very small part of the image. Therefore, most of the removed spots are in the background area, while these small organs (anomalies) are of greater importance. One of the most difficult tasks in analyzing medical images is the segmentation of medical images, which identifies pixels or organ damage from medical background images such as CT or MRI images. The main goal of the lung region extraction process is to capture the lung region and determine the regions of interest (ROI) on the CT image.
